It’s not like Phee would be meeting 1 on 1 with Cathy to negotiate the CBA. She is one of three VPs on the WNBAPA executive committee. Nneka Ogumike is the President. Other members: Brianna Stewart, Elizabeth Williams, Kelsey Plum, Alysha Clark, Brianna Turner and Satou Sabally. And lots of lawyers.
